What is being bought

Department for Education are looking for a provider to enhance the development and use of case management systems (CMS) in children’s social care to enable social workers to spend more time with families. This contract is due to commence 1st September 2023 and will run until June 2024. Departmental research has concluded that technology used by social workers to record their work with children, support social workers in their day-to-day work, and collect statutory and local data could be improved or standardised. Whilst local authorities are responsible for funding and managing their digital estate, the department made a commitment in the recent Stable Homes, Built on Love strategy to improve case management systems to enable social workers to spend more time directly with children and families.

Lot details

Lot 1

We are seeking a supplier to facilitate LAs to agree and articulate the minimum core functionalities (MCF) that a Children’s Social Care CMS (Case Management System) should have, based on multiple user needs. The supplier will map existing market products against the minimum core functionalities as well as survey the wider landscape of digital systems and products that consume and use children’s social care data or interact with children’s social care case management products, as well as the stakeholders who either have a role to play in shaping, or are impacted by, the development of children’s social care systems and standards. The supplier will also appraise options for how open data and technical standards for Children’s Social Care to support the movement of information across systems and agencies (in the mapped ecosystem) could be developed, governed, and implemented and maintained and finally develop and trial a set of 3-4 interoperability-oriented data and technical open standards for interoperability-oriented use cases prioritised by the user community – and located within the mapped ecosystem, and review the applicability of existing standards initiatives to CSC CMS.
